Cumulative CAMAG Bibliography Service CCBS

Our CCBS database includes more than 11,000 abstracts of publications. Perform your own detailed search of TLC/HPTLC literature and find relevant information.

The Cumulative CAMAG Bibliography Service CCBS contains all abstracts of CBS issues beginning with CBS 51. The database is updated after the publication of every other CBS edition. Currently the Cumulative CAMAG Bibliography Service includes more than 11'000 abstracts of publications between 1983 and today. With the online version you can perform your own detailed TLC/HPTLC literature search:

  • Full text search: Enter a keyword, e.g. an author's name, a substance, a technique, a reagent or a term and see all related publications
  • Browse and search by CBS classification: Select one of the 38 CBS classification categories where you want to search by a keyword
  • Keyword register: select an initial character and browse associated keywords
  • Search by CBS edition: Select a CBS edition and find all related publications

Registered users can create a tailor made PDF of selected articles throughout CCBS search – simply use the cart icon on the right hand of each abstract to create your individual selection of abstracts. You can export your saved items to PDF by clicking the download icon.

      93 120
      (Study of the quality standard of Shentaipikang pills
      H. LU (Lu Hua)*, J. XING (Xing Jianguo), T. WU (Wu Tao) (*Section Med., Taixing Hosp., Taixing, Jiangsu 225400, P. R. China)

      J. Chinese Trad. Patent Med. (Zhongchengyao) 25 (10), 798-801 (2004). TLC on silica gel with 1) ethyl acetate - butanone - formic acid - water 10:7:1:1; 2) benzene - acetone 10:1; 3) petroleum ether - ethyl formate - glacial acetic acid 18:1:1. Detection 1) under UV 365 nm, 2) by spraying with 5 % solution of vanillin - acetic acid - perchloric acid and heating at 105 ºC, 3) by spraying with 10 % H2SO4 in ethanol and heating at 105 ºC. Identification by fingerprint techniques. Quantitation of icariine by HPLC.

      Classification: 4d, 32c
      93 140
      (Study of the quality standard for Shengxue capsules
      H. TU (Tu Honghai)*, R. ZHAO (Zhao Ruhai), Y. WEI (Wei Youliang), C. WANG (Wang Caiyun) (*The hosp. 68210 PLA, Baoji, Sahnxi 721001, P. R. China)

      J. Chinese Trad. Patent Med. (Zhongchengyao) 25 (9), 708-711 (2004). TLC on silica gel with 1) n-hexane - ethyl acetate 9:1, 2) ethyl acetate - chloroform - methanol - formic acid - water 10:5:5:1:1, 3) chloroform - methanol - water 90:5:1. Detection 1) under UV 365 nm and by spraying with 20 % perchloric acid solution and heating at 105 ºC, 2) by spraying with 10 % H2SO4 in ethanol and heating at 105 ºC for 10 min, 3) by ammonia vapor and under UV 254 nm. Identification by fingerprint techniques. Quantitation of astragaloside by densitometry at 530 nm. Discussion of use of the procedures for the quality control of the medicine.

      Classification: 32c
      93 158
      (Study of the quality standard of Chongcaoyangshen capsules
      X. YANG (YANG XIXONG), CH. YANG (YANG CHENGXONG), L. FU (FU LIANQUN), J. LU (LU JINQING) (Jingmen Hosp. No.2, Jingmen, Hubei 448000, P. R. China)

      J. Chinese Trad. Patent Med. (Zhongchengyao) 10, 858-860 (2004). TLC on silica gel with 1) chloroform - methanol - water 13:7:2, 2) isopropanol - ethyl acetate - water 17:9:9, n-butanol - formic acid - water 15:3:2. Detection 1) by spraying with 10 % H2SO4 in ethanol and heating at 110 ºC, 2) by spraying with 0.3 % ninhydrin in n-butanol, 3) by spraying with 10 % vanillin solution. Identification by fingerprint techniques. Quantitative determination of ginsenoside by HPLC.

      Classification: 4d, 32c
      94 057
      (Study of the quality control of Xinyihao capsules
      X. CHEN (Chen Xiaolin) (Xiamen TCM Co., Ltd., Xiamen, Fujian 361009, China)

      Chinese J. Trad. Patent Med. (Zhongchengyao) 26 (6), Appendix 7-8 (2004). TLC of Xinyihao capsule extracts on silica gel with 1) chloroform - methanol - water 13:7:2; cyclohexane - acetone - chloroform 5:3:3. Detection 1) by spraying with 10 % H2SO4 solution in ethanol and heating at 110 ºC ; 2) under UV 365 nm. Identification by fingerprint techniques. Quantification of borneol by GC with method validation.

      Classification: 32c
      94 081
      (Study of the quality standard for Fuketiaojing tablets
      J. MENG (Meng Jun)*, Y. GONG (Gong Yun), Y. DING (Ding Ye) (*Beijing Jiaotong Univ., Beijing 100009, China)

      Chinese J. Trad. Patent Med. (Zhongchengyao) 26 (7), 541-544 (2004). TLC of Fuketiaojing tablet extracts on silica gel with 1) benzene - ethyl acetate - glacial acetic acid 2:1:1; 2) benzene - ethyl acetate- glacial acetic acid 92:5:5; 3) cyclo hexane - ethyl acetate 7:3; 4) chloroform - methanol - water 30:10:1. Detection 1) under UV 254 nm; 2) by spraying with p-dimethylaminobenzaldehyde-H2SO4 solution and heating at 130 ºC and under UV 365 nm; 3) by spraying with 10 % H2SO4 solution in ethanol and heating at 105 ºC; 4) by spraying with 5 % vanillin-H2SO4 solution and heating at 105 ºC. Identification by fingerprint technique. Quantification of ferulic acid by HPLC.

      Classification: 32c
      94 100
      Simultaneous estimation of ginkgo biloba and ginseng from pharmaceutical solid dosage form by HPTLC
      S. Y. GANDHE, A. D. SATHAYE, S. V. PIMPLE, M. A. JOSHI (Emcure R & D Centre, T-184 MIDC Bhosari, Pune – 411026, India)

      Indian Drugs 41 (6), 362-365 (2004). HPTLC on silica gel with n-butane - n-propanol - glacial acetic acid - water - chloroform 4:1:1:1:2 with addition of formic acid in proportion of 1:0.001. Densitometric evaluation of ginkgo biloba extract by absorbance measurement at 254 nm. The same plate was used for the quantitative determination of ginseng at 520 nm after spraying with ninhydrin reagent. A simple, fast and precise HPTLC method has been developed for the simultaneous determination of ginkgo biloba and ginseng in solid dosage form.

      Classification: 32a
      95 055
      Simultaneous HPTLC determination of imidazole antimycotics and parabens in creams
      Mira CAKAR*, G. POPOVIC, S. VLADIMIROV (*Faculty of Pharmacy, University of Belgrade, Vojvode Stepe 450, P. O. Box 146, 11000 Belgrade, Serbia and Montenegro)

      J. Planar Chromatogr. 17, 177-180 (2004). HPTLC of bifonazole, econazole nitrate, methyl- and propylparaben on silica gel with ethyl acetate - n-hexane - methanol - ammonia - diethylamine 5:40:8:4:20 in a twin-trough chamber. Quantitation by scanning in reflectance/absorbance mode at 230 nm (econazole nitrate), 250 nm (bifonazole), and 300 nm (parabens).

      Classification: 32a
      95 072
      (Separation and purification of the active fraction of Sinisan powder with macroporous resins) (Chinese)
      CH. LI (Li Chuncheng), X. YANG (Yang Xinghao)*, J. CUI (Cui Jinghao, Y. WANG (Wang Yanfei), J. ZHU (Zhu Jia) (*Pharm. R & D Centre, Nanjing Normal Univ., Nanjing 210097, China)

      Chinese J. Trad. Pat. Med. (Zhongchengyao) 27(1), 84-87 (2005). TLC screening of Sinisan powder extracts, purified with macroporous resins, on silica gel with 1) n-butanol - ammonia - ethanol 7:3:1; 2) chloroform - methanol 7:1. Detection 1) by spraying with 5 % AICI3 in ethanol 2) by spraying with 5 % vanillin - H2SO4 solution. Identification by fingerprint technique. Screening of purification conditions by evaluation of the content of the active principle, and yield of the purified products. Type HP20 macroporous resin has been concluded to be the optimum for active fraction of the recipe in purification efficiency.

      Classification: 32c
